The amount of the settlement or verdict for mesothelioma varies on the type and amount of the victim's exposure to asbestos. Generally speaking, there are two types of mesothelioma-related damages that are awarded in cases: economic and noneconomic. Economic damages are easy to calculate and include medical expenses, lost wages and other expenses associated with the patient's diagnosis. Noneconomic damages, on the other hand, Asbestos cancer lawsuit lawyer mesothelioma settlement are much harder to quantify and can include the victim's pain and suffering. These damages are typically awarded by a juror.

Based on the laws of each state mesothelioma sufferers must comply with certain timeframes to bring a lawsuit. Statutes of limitations typically allow individuals to sue asbestos companies for up to five years after diagnosis or discovery. This time period does not apply to claims for wrongful deaths that are filed on behalf of deceased family members.

Many companies that exposed workers to asbestos have closed or declared bankruptcy. In the end, asbestos-related victims still have the option of receiving compensation from asbestos trust funds. These funds have over $30 billion allocated to compensate mesothelioma patients and their surviving relatives.
